Subject:

Oconee Nuclear Station Docket Number 50-269, 50-270, 50-287 Emergency Response Data System (ERDS) 10CFR50, Appendix E, Section VI, 3a requires that any software change that affects the transmitted data points identified in the Emergency Response Data System (ERDS)

Data Point Library must be submitted to the NRC within 30 days after changes are completed.

Editorial changes to the Data Point Library were due to Engineering Changes EC#77069 and EC #77070, associated with the Unit 3 Reactor Protection System Replacement which was completed during our recent U3EC26 outage. These changes are editorial in nature and will not affect parameters or ranges required by the NRC.

The ERDS parameter points affected are attached for your information and to update your Data Point Library.

If there are any questions regarding the software change, please contact Ray Waterman at (864) 873-3825.
